Ingredients of Healthy bean burger sandwich
- You need 100 grams of boiled kidney beans.
- It’s 100 grams of boiled black eyed beans.
- Prepare 50 grams of boiled green peas.
- Prepare to taste of Sea salt.
- You need 2 of boiled, peeled and mashed potatoes.
- You need 6 of cheddar cheese slices.
- It’s 1 teaspoon of all spice powder.
- Prepare 1 tablespoon of cumin seeds.
- You need 1 teaspoon of red chilli powder.
- You need 1 teaspoon of oregano powder.
- Prepare 100 grams of finely chopped parsley/coriander leaves.
- It’s 250 grams of breads crumbs.
- Prepare 1 of small onion chopped finely.
- It’s 1 of small tomato chopped in rings/roundels.
- You need 1 of large onion peeled and chopped in roundels/rings.
- Prepare of As required Lettuce leaves to serve.
- Prepare As needed of Burger buns to serve.
- You need of Some oil to drizzle pre baking.

Healthy bean burger sandwich step by step
Preheat the oven 180 degrees celcius.
Combine the beans and peas in a bowl and mash well.
Add the mashed beans-peas to the mashed potatoes.
Add the finely chopped onion, salt, coriander leaves and other dry spices.
Mix all the ingredients well.
Create medium sized burger patties with the mixture.
Spread the bread crumbs on a plate well.
Coat all the patties well with the bread crumbs.
Align the baking tray with a baking sheet and place the patties keeping 2 fingers distance between each.
Drizzle/brush some oil on the patties.
Place the tray in the oven and bake until crisp(about 25-30 minutes). Flip half way through for even baking.
Post baking let the patties cool a bit before preparing the burger.
To plate, slice the buns into half.
Place lettuce leaf and a patty on top. Arrange a cheese slice,1-2 onion and tomato rings.
Serve warm with ketchup immediately.
